CHOMPER in Ohio Heavy equipment sale







CHOMPER SUPER 14
[665912]

                    CHOMPER SUPER 14
CHOMPER SUPER 14
Morris and Sons Farms & Equipment
Xenia, Ohio
  • 1
Back to top